Navigating the complexities of the human body can seem daunting, but understanding basic immune functions is essential for everyone, not just healthcare professionals. This article demystifies how the immune system works and offers practical ways to support it through everyday choices.

Defining pathogens, antigens, and allergens

At the core of immune function is the battle against pathogens—organisms such as viruses, bacteria, and fungi that can cause illness. Not all microbes are harmful; many are beneficial residents in our body. Problems arise when they multiply uncontrollably. The immune system recognises threats through specific components called antigens. For example, the spike protein on the coronavirus is an antigen that signals an invasion.

Antibodies and B cells: the precision tools of immunity

Antibodies are specialised proteins produced by B cells that bind to antigens. Each B cell creates a unique antibody designed for a particular threat. When antibodies recognise their target, they trigger the immune system to mount a response. This process—known as adaptive immunity—allows the body to fine-tune its defences for stronger, targeted protection.

Innate and adaptive immunity: first responders and special forces

The immune system operates on two levels. Innate immunity acts as the body’s immediate first line of defence, with macrophages and neutrophils engulfing and destroying pathogens. Adaptive immunity builds over time, with B cells and T cells learning to identify and neutralise specific invaders. Together, they form a comprehensive defence system.

T Cells: The silent assassins

Killer T cells are crucial for addressing infections that hide inside our own cells, where antibodies cannot reach. These T cells detect and destroy infected cells, preventing pathogens from multiplying and spreading.

The power of immune memory

One of the immune system’s most remarkable features is memory. After infection or vaccination, memory cells remain primed to respond quickly if the same pathogen returns. This is why vaccinations are effective—they train the immune system without causing the illness itself.

Managing collateral damage

While the immune response is vital, it can sometimes cause temporary side effects such as fever or inflammation. These are natural signs that the body is fighting infection. Vaccines work by safely stimulating this process, giving the immune system practice for future encounters.

Everyday ways to support immune health

Supporting immune function doesn’t require complex interventions. Small, consistent lifestyle choices can make a big difference:

  • Drink water regularly to support natural detoxification.

  • Eat a diet rich in fruit, vegetables, whole grains, and lean protein.

  • Limit sugar, caffeine, and alcohol, which may affect immune balance.

  • Get adequate sleep to restore and strengthen immune defences.

  • Exercise moderately, such as brisk walking, to enhance immune resilience.

  • Manage stress with mindfulness, meditation, or yoga. Chronic stress can weaken immune responses.
